So I was called to assist at an accident scene this morning and had to negotiate with an impatient transito and a foreigner who had hit the car of some Mexicans. The foreigner had a car with South Dakota plates and an insurance policy that covered her foreign plated car although she did not have the policy with her.

I called her agent, got her policy information and the claims number, called the claims number and gave them her info, policy info and car info. An hour later the adjuster shows up and say he needs the original policy. we went round and round to not have the car towed as the adjustor would not guarantee coverage and was requiring the client ask the insurance company for another original policy even though he could easily check that the policy was paid and even though a few blocks from the accident scene was a Qualitas insurance office.

Moral of the story, keep the original of the insurance policy in your vehicle if your insurer is Qualitas and if you cannot fine the original then ask the company to issue you another original. They wouldn´t accept a scanned copy either! We were able to negotiate with all parties but had things been more serious somebody could have gone to jail and had their car towed all due to the ridiculous insistence on having an original policy in the car!

I dont think some of the Canadians and Americans here understand what happens in case of an accident; up north all you need is proof of insurance to show the cop and then an accident report from the police to send to the insurance company. In Mexico, you call the police and the insurance company who sends an adjuster to the scene of the accident and then all the adjusters and police get together and decide who is paying what.

In the nearly 6 years I have been here I have had 2 claims with Qualitas of about $35,000 US total. Yes, the adjuster wants to see the original policy (which I had in the car both times). Both times the adjusters told me that they make decisions on the spot based on the policy you have with you; no policy, no decision - that can be a big problem.

I do have a Mexican plated car now but I would highly recommend Lewis & Lewis with Qualitas for foreign plated vehicles.

US and Canada liability inurance for $1,200,000 pesos, price was good and they offer a free auto part etching service if your car is worth over 80,000 pesos and if you do it, reduces chance of theft of parts and they will lower your theft deductible. Their rates were less than other, got quotes ranging from 7,700 pesos (Qualitas) to $14,000 pesos a year for full coverage. Vehicle value $200,000 pesos.
